Steve Carell in Talks to Join Star-Studded ‘The Big Short’

With the news The Big Short, I would say anticipation for the adaptation of the Michael Lewis book about the build up of the housing bubble spiked. Well, people, you might be seeing yet another big name above the title on the poster.

Steve Carell, who is vying for an Oscar nomination tomorrow morning for his terrific performance in Foxcatcher, is in talks to join The Big Short. He would be reteaming with his Anchorman: The Legend of Ron Burgundy writer/director Adam McKay for, obviously, a very different kind of movie.
